Experience the grandeur of London's Buckingham Palace with LEGO® Buckingham Palace 21029. This stunning LEGO® Architecture set, released in September 2016, is part of the Landmark Series and features 780 pieces for an engaging and rewarding building experience. The neoclassical facade of the palace's east wing, complete with the Royal Standard flag, forecourt, and palace gates, is beautifully recreated in LEGO form. The set also includes a section of the Mall with the iconic Victoria Memorial, a red double-decker bus, and a black taxicab, adding to the authenticity of this architectural masterpiece. LEGO 21029 is a must-have for anyone with a passion for architecture, travel, history, and design. The included booklet provides fascinating information about the design, architecture, and history of Buckingham Palace, making it a perfect addition to any home or office display. Measuring 3” (10cm) high, 7” (20cm) wide, and 7” (19cm) deep, this set offers an age-appropriate building experience for ages 12 and up. After retiring in January 2018, LEGO Set 21029 had been on shelves for 27 months. Its current new, sealed value is $125, showing a 151% growth from the RRP of $50. This growth averages 14.8% per annum. This set is composed of 780 pieces. It''s part of the Architecture theme with 63 sets, 46 of which are retired, showing an average annual growth of 113%. It belongs to the Landmark Series sub-theme, which includes 36 sets, 28 retired, with an average growth rate of 92%.
